Jean Alberta Rhoades, 78, of Lexington Park, MD passed away peacefully on April 13, 2021 in Leonardtown, MD.
Born in Winthrop MA, the beloved daughter of the late Ralph and Augusta (Smith) Ford, she was a 1962 graduate of Winthrop High School. She obtained her Home Health Aid certification and dedicated her life to the care of others. Prior to her retirement, Jean was employed by Asbury Assisted Living Retirement Community in Solomons, MD for 21 years as a Certified Nursing Assistant.
Jean was a dedicated Mother who completely cherished every moment with her immediate and extended family. She also valued all of her friendships to which she formed throughout her life. She enjoyed BINGO, Crocheting, Lighthouses, Crabbing, the beach, swimming, cooking Lasagna or eating Lobster /Scallops/Clams. She loved watching Wheel of Fortune and Jeopardy, Victory Woods deer and birds with her friends from her "treehouse", and Breton Bay sunsets with family.
